Transaction ae3c836aedc9632122aba6f8f3c94a9d4bf6957b5fd5a43240e4fa5f3611ccb6
1 Input
1 Output
-
ae3c836aedc9632122aba6f8f3c94a9d4bf6957b5fd5a43240e4fa5f3611ccb6:0
- value
- 63450984
- script pubkey
- OP_0 OP_PUSHBYTES_20 c750ad84672f16124ce6a43e39966431e83fe4ce
- address
- bc1qcag2mpr89utpyn8x5slrn9nyx85rlexw5m5c66